A new report has found that a proposed gas development in the Lake Eyre Basin in QLD could increase national carbon emissions by 60%.

The proposed gas development in the environmentally fragile Basin Area has been done so without the consultation of local traditional owners and experts have said that if just 25% of the gas was recovered, that would be ‘incompatible’ with QLD’s emission reduction targets. 

The state government has stated that its targets are achievable with the state already reportedly reduced emissions by 14% since 2005, however it remains unclear how these new gas developments factor into the state’s emissions targets
